9. Leases

Effective July 1, 2019, the Company adopted Accounting Standards Codification (“ASC”) Topic 842 - Leases using the modified retrospective transition approach and electing the package of practical expedients. This resulted in the recognition of right-of-use assets of $441 and total operating lease liabilities of $463. There was no cumulative-effect adjustment recorded to retained earnings upon adoption.

The Company leases its Texas manufacturing facilities under an operating lease agreement. During the nine months ended March 31, 2020, the Company exercised its option to extend the term of this lease agreement by one year, so that it now expires in April 2021. The Company also leases office equipment under lease agreements that expire at various dates through April 2024.

The Company also leases its Minnesota headquarters facility as discussed in Note 6. This transaction did not qualify for sale leaseback accounting upon adoption of ASC 842 and continues to be accounted for as a financing obligation.

Operating lease right-of-use assets and liabilities are recognized based on the present value of future minimum lease payments over the lease term at commencement dates. The Company considers fixed or variable payment terms, prepayments, incentives, and options to extend, terminate or purchase. Renewal, termination or purchase options affect the lease term used for determining lease asset value only if the option is reasonably certain to be exercised. The Company uses its incremental borrowing rate based on information available at the lease commencement date in determining the present value of lease payments unless the lease provides an implicit interest rate.

Operating lease cost is classified within the consolidated statement of operations based on the nature of the leased asset. The Company's operating lease cost was $121 and $362 for the three and nine months ended March 31, 2020, respectively. Cash paid for operating lease liabilities approximated operating lease cost for the nine months ended March 31, 2020. There was $437 of operating lease right-of-use assets obtained in exchange for new lease liabilities during the nine months ended March 31, 2020.

As of March 31, 2020, the weighted average remaining lease term for operating leases was 1.2 years and the weighted average discount rate used to determine operating lease liabilities was 5.25%.
